Gothenburg City Mission is a mission-driven, non-profit organization working to support people living in vulnerable life situations. Together, we want to create a Gothenburg where everyone is included. A city where we meet the person, not the problem. ABOUT US The Kitchen and Restaurant unit is part of Gothenburg City Mission's food-related activities, within the area of Work Integration. An important part of our mission is to offer work training for people who are far from the labor market. In all our activities, we combine cooking with social commitment. With us, people have the opportunity to develop, strengthen their skills, and take steps closer to work or studies. Together we prepare high-quality meals while contributing to a more sustainable and inclusive society. The Kitchen and Restaurant unit consists of two large kitchens and a restaurant, located in different parts of Gothenburg. The large kitchens deliver hot and packaged cold food to both City Mission's own activities and to external customers. At Restaurant Svinn, we serve lunch and also work with catering for both workplaces and private individuals through procurement with the City of Gothenburg. We strive to cook with ingredients from our Food Center as much as possible. There we receive food that has been donated to Gothenburg City Mission for various reasons and that would otherwise have risked becoming food waste. By using these ingredients, we reduce food waste and contribute to a more sustainable food system. The differences between schools, where you live, where you come from, and what your parents do increasingly determine your chances of succeeding in school. Foundation Läxhjälpen is a non-profit organization that operates where the need is greatest. Läxhjälpen is free for students, and tutor salaries are financed through support from the business sector and public sector. Läxhjälpen is a concrete initiative addressing one of Sweden's biggest challenges today—increasing numbers of young people not succeeding in school and risking exclusion from society. Carefully selected, paid university/college students help young people with their studies two evenings a week and simultaneously serve as positive role models and mentors. Since our founding in 2007, we have developed a structured methodology and a clear goal—to improve grades and help students progress to upper secondary school. Today we operate in over 90 schools in Stockholm, Södertälje, Västerås, Norrköping, Gothenburg, Landskrona, Umeå, Sundsvall, Uppsala, Gävle, and Malmö, among others. About the Company LUMIBIRD is one of the world's leading specialists in lasers, with over 50 years of experience and expertise in three key technologies: solid state lasers, laser diodes, and fiber lasers. The company designs, manufactures, and markets high-performance lasers for scientific (laboratories and universities), industrial (manufacturing, defense, LIDAR sensors), and medical (ophthalmology, ultrasound) markets. LUMIBIRD was founded through a merger of the Keopsys and Quantel groups in October 2017, and is today a mid-sized company with over 800 employees, revenue exceeding €126 million, and offices in Europe, North America, China, Japan, and Australia. Saab's laser operations were acquired by LUMIBIRD in June 2022 and are now conducted under the name Lumibird Photonics Sweden AB on Kallebäcksberget in Gothenburg. About IPEN: IPEN – International Pollutants Elimination Network (www.ipen.org) was founded in 1998 and is registered as a Swedish non-profit association. IPEN's members are supported by a secretariat with five employees in Gothenburg and ten employees based in, among other places, the USA, the Philippines, and Australia. We are financed by Swedish and international development agencies, including Sida.

About Indoor Energy: Indoor Energy is a Swedish corporation that works with energy efficiency and technical facility services, focusing on systems for heating, cooling, ventilation, and control technology in buildings. The company offers comprehensive solutions covering everything from design and installation to service and maintenance, with the goal of optimizing energy use and creating a better indoor climate. The corporation was founded in 1990 and has extensive experience in energy systems and facility technology. Today, Indoor Energy has around 200 employees and operates at several locations throughout Sweden, from Luleå in the north to Gothenburg in the south. The business consists of several companies with different areas of specialization, enabling the corporation to offer broad expertise in energy and installation.
